History of Doom series.

Back in 1992, Id Software is best known for FPS classic games like Wolfenstein 3d which is a first FPS game came on PC before the original Doom released in 1993 which became successful FPS game on PC which praises for solid gameplay, graphics engine, best music track comes with heavy metal ambient composed by Bobby Prince and online muiltiplayer battle became the first PC games supports online networking. While Doom is became best FPS game for PC in 1993, it's also became a controversial due to graphic violence and satanic themes which had became a biggest video game controversy of all time. Id Software have brought the sequel called Doom 2 released in 1994 which had became a another great sequel to original Doom. In 1997, Doom 64 came for Nintendo 64 with different graphics engine and same gameplay as original Doom. It quite lot darker than the original to make the game look like a proper horror genre in FPS game but it's a decent game for N64 but it was'nt just good as the original. In between 2004 and 2005, Id Software brings Doom 3 for PC and Xbox comes with newer gameplay and graphics, more darker elements, new monster, improved weapons and different storyplot. It became the greatest FPS game around in 2005. Id Software are considering to make a sequel to Doom 3 in sometime future perfect.

Doom 3: BFG Edition PS3 Review

Doom 3: BFG Edition is a updated version of original Doom 3 for PS3, X360 and PC.
This game came with HD graphics with 3D support which is a new thing for seventh generation consoles. It has a expansion pack level featured from resurrection of evil including lost levels which is cool to have a extra level and It has a 2 classics Doom games which I already have both for PC but it has a split screen muiltiplayer for console version.
Lets move on to Doom 3 storyplot. This story take place in planet mars, the main character Doomguy came to UAC's Mars Base to meet up with Master Sergeant orders him to find scientist from a Delta Lab who had gone missing. UAC's Mars Base was been attacked by demons from hell attempts to kill the scientist and marines. Doomguy sets his mission to defend himself in UAC's Mars Base to fight off the demons.
For the gameplay,the gameplay engine is quite different from the 2004 version which developed by Vicarious Visons while the BFG Edition is handled by Bethesda Softworks for PS3 and X360. The controls scheme is good for movements and combat system which is quite same thing as the 2004. The weapons is decent for shooting range, good targeting and quality weapons choices like pistols, shotgun, machine gun, chain gun, grenades, rocket launcher, plasma gun, chainsaw and one of the best weapons of all time is BFG 9000 (aka Big F-ing Gun 9000) shoots with green plasma bullet to melt 3 or 4 demons including big monsters. The levels has a good challenging with puzzle solving and boss fights. It does have a save features on pause menu which you don't have to start the level all over again, save features will let you save the game on the place where you at.
The graphics are ok'ay but pretty look dated, the lighting is lot higher compared to original Xbox version is look darker and better details. some textures and background are look cleaner and then the character design is lot same, it is nice with 3D glasses on with some better details is lot better than using the normal video settings. Graphics isn't important thing, it's all about the gameplay thats matters the most important things in gaming.
The music and sound has a great horror ambient music, good voice acting for characters and decent sound effects.
The special features is just what you need. It has a 3D glasses support and online muiltiplayer battle, expansion pack of Resurrection of evil including 8 lost levels and 2 classics Doom games what Id Software have offers to their fans to enjoy the game with extra features.

Final Verdict

Is it worth buying this or stick it to original version instead, lets see.


Gameplay 7.5/10 - Good controls scheme, decent combat system and good challenge of levels.

Graphics 6.8/10 - It's an okay graphics for normal video setting but look better on 3D counterpart. Too much lighting isn't dark enough, some cleaner textures and backgrounds and then the character models looked the same.

Music and Sounds 8/10 - Great horror ambient music, good voice acting and decent sound effects.

Special Features 8/10 - Expansion pack of Resurrection of evil with 8 lost levels, 3D glasses support, online battle and 2 classic Doom games is just what you all needed.

Overall 7.1/10 - It's a decent update game for PS3 and X360. If you're a PS3 and X360 gamers out there, then it's worth to buy it. If you already have a original version for Xbox and PC, then stick with them instead.
